Comments:
Diffuse large B-cell lymphoma involving the kidney in a 70 y/o male. The tumor consists of an intrarenal component as well as a perinephric mass, together measuring about 28 cm in greatest dimension. Immunophenotyping using flow cytometry revealed a population of CD19+ and CD20+ B-cells that were monotypic for lambda immunoglobulin light chains. The patient had previous history of non-Hodgkin lymphoma involving mesenteric lymph nodes. In most cases, the renal involvement is secondary and occurs in the setting of systemic disease. Primary renal lymphomas, however, do occur.
